Coinbase Plans to File Movement Difficult SEC Lawsuit


Coinbase plans to file a petition looking for the dismissal
of a lawsuit introduced by the Securities and Trade Fee (SEC). The
cryptocurrency trade is planning to argue in court docket that it didn’t listing securities on its
platform and that the SEC has no jurisdiction over crypto exchanges.

The Chief Authorized Officer
of Coinbase, Paul Grewal, made the announcement yesterday (Thursday) in the course of the
trade’s earnings name. Grewal expressed optimism that Coinbase was
prone to win the case towards the regulator.

The SEC
sued
Coinbase in June
for allegedly working its crypto asset buying and selling platform illegally and
providing unregistered securities. Moreover, the regulator claims that
Coinbase comingled and illegally provided the providers of trade,
broker-dealer, and clearinghouse, which based on the legislation governing
securities, must have been separated.

Coinbase maintains that
there isn’t any regulatory readability for the digital asset sector and that the
regulators appear to have conflicting stances on digital property. The trade cited statements issued by the SEC and the CFTC relating to whether or not Ether is a commodity or a safety.

In March, CFTC’s
Chairman, Rostin Behnam, reiterated that Ether is a commodity, whereas the SEC maintains that every one
cryptocurrencies besides Bitcoin are securities. Nonetheless, in a
longstanding authorized battle between the SEC and Ripple , a choose in New York
issued a landmark judgement that cryptocurrency XRP was not
thought of a safety
when
bought to retail traders.

“Nonetheless, regardless of our
good religion efforts and transparency of our enterprise to the SEC for years now, we had been deeply disenchanted
that the SEC introduced an unwarranted enforcement motion towards us in June, and that
ten states initiated proceedings about our staking providers,” Coinbase
stated.

Coinbase Q2 Earnings

Coinbase reported a ten%
quarter-over-quarter decline in income to USD $662 million. Moreover that, the trade
reported a 13% quarter-over-quarter decline in transaction income as a consequence of a
drop in buying and selling volumes. Equally, Coinbase’s income from the
client phase declined 12% quarter-over-quarter.

On August 1, a federal choose in Manhattan opined that cryptocurrencies may very well be thought of
securities whatever the context through which they’re marketed. The opinion appears to contradict an earlier assertion issued in the identical jurisdiction involving the case between the SEC and Ripple, which said the alternative.
